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31770 5131 330 14017120931
9658080772 07401969 6521688888
9658080772 07401969 6521688888
5746220 44357 3350
All about undefined
Interested in learning more?
9658080772 07401969 6521688888
5746220 44357 3350
See more
2197411 68 6771850589
921812563 214 0811 471825
See more
35177441379 586491612 8353586
351883 067 82660
See more